What is Individual Therapy?

Individual therapy offers a dedicated space for you to slow down, reflect, and reconnect with yourself. Whether you’re navigating anxiety, life transitions, relationship stress, grief, or feeling stuck, therapy provides support that is both grounded and tailored to your unique experience.

My approach to individual therapy is integrative and personalized. I draw from a range of evidence-based and body-centered modalities to meet you where you are and support meaningful, lasting change.

Mind-Body Integration

As a trained yoga instructor (CYT-200 trained in Trauma Recovery Yoga), I bring a strong mind-body perspective into my work. When appropriate, sessions may include gentle somatic awareness, grounding exercises, breathwork, or mindfulness practices to support nervous system regulation and deepen your connection to yourself.

This work is always collaborative and paced in a way that feels safe and supportive for you.
